This print showcases the exquisite Nef belonging to Empress Josephine de Beauharnais, a remarkable piece from 1804. Crafted in silver-gilt by the talented Auguste Henry, this masterpiece is housed at the majestic Chateau de Fontainebleau in Seine-et-Marne, France. The Nef is an embodiment of opulence and elegance, reflecting the grandeur of the First Empire style. Its intricate design features a stunning ship or boat as its central motif, adorned with delicate relief work and ornate tableware. The figures depicted on this centrepiece are engaged in animated conversation, adding life and dynamism to the scene. Empress Josephine herself was known for her impeccable taste and love for neo-classical art. This elaborate piece served as a symbol of her status as Napoleon Bonaparte's wife and showcased her refined aesthetic sensibilities. The argent surface of this Nef adds a touch of luxury while highlighting its importance as part of an impressive surtout de table or table centerpiece. The figurehead at its bow further enhances its regal allure.
